Montgomery College Takoma Park/Silver Spring Campus has an immediate need for a full-time Administrative Aide II in the Department of Counseling and Advising. The work schedule is Monday Friday 8:30 a.m. 5:00 p.m. This is a bargaining non-exempt grade 19 position. For non-exempt positions you are not eligible to work a secondary job at Montgomery College. Montgomery College promotes and creates a working and learning environment rooted in the basic tenets of fairness belonging and inclusiveness. This position is eligible for telework 1 day a week after the completed probationary period. This eligibility is subject to change based on the needs of the unit.

The work involves providing administrative technical and support services to an academic or administrative unit and facilitating the administrative procedures related to the programs and services offered by the office including department events. Assigned administrative support tasks involve technical decisions regarding processing of actions (i.e. budget personnel purchasing); research information in the files and providing the results to the supervisor; and/or maintenance of unit financial records and web page(s). The incumbent in this position communicates with others throughout the College and external entities to obtain and provide information arranges appointments and staff schedules and organizes office routines; and speaks for supervisor on matters on which the supervisors views are known or as otherwise authorized.

Duties include but are not limited to:

  • Performs general administrative duties and ensures compliance with established policies and procedures regarding office services College protocols and administrative requirements.
  • Assist students with all front desk operations related to Student Services.
  • Answers phones opens and routes mail types and creates various communications (e.g. correspondences flyers letters syllabi tests and/or reports) by typing from draft documents and subsequently proofs and edits the documents.
  • As initial point of contact for office directs calls and walk-ins to appropriate staff or departments.
  • Manages and maintains supervisors schedule and calendar for scheduling of conference and room space; orders supplies through various vendors; hires trains and supervises student assistants; and assists students; maintains manual and/or automated financial accounting personnel and other administrative and management files and records ensuring confidentiality where appropriate; attends meetings takes summary notes and distributes notes and minutes; reviews and verifies information on forms and documents submitted to the academic or administrative department.
  • Performs calculation or coding and enters data into appropriate systems.
  • As directed using approved software and operating within the overall guidelines set by the College manages one or more web pages for the academic or administrative area which may include adding modifying or removing content as to reflect the organizations programs and operations.
  • Provides technical support by processing actions relating to the budget personnel or purchasing to include purchase requisition and submitting the actions for the supervisors approval.
  • Coordinates departmental events.
  • Assists students and staff with computer workstations; submit and track trouble tickets for IT assistance; may perform hardware/software assessment and make recommendations.
  • May manage vendor contracts for building maintenance; communicate facility issues and coordinate and schedule all vendor deliveries.
  • Train and supervise student workers.
  • Manage priorities projects and stakeholder needs simultaneously in a busy office environment.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.

Required Qualifications:

  • High school diploma or GED including or supplemented by course in word processing and office practices.
  • At least three years of progressively responsible experience performing general office and secretarial duties involving customer service.
  • Knowledge of office support procedures and practice including English usage to include spelling grammar writing styles and formats; basic mathematical computations; record keeping principles and procedures; and PC hardware and skill in using PC software and office applications.
  • Eligible applicants must currently be authorized to work in the United States and not require employer visa sponsorship

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Prior experience with Workday OneDrive and Teams
  • Familiarity with budget spreadsheets and higher education programs such as Starfish Banner and Maxient.
  • Prior experience working with Student Services.

Hiring Range: $22.48-$28.11 hourly. Initial salary placement for new hires falls between the minimum and midpoint of the range and is based on relevant candidate experience and internal equity. The maximum salary for this position is $33.73.
